On Tuesday 28th November, we have a special edition of our popular Storytime feature as it coincides with the annual Thanksgiving Day parade.

Designed and implemented to be free for everyone! Our popular weekly Storytime program introduces young children to books, rhymes, music and other fun activities. New Woodstock Free Library offers programs matched to the typical attention spans and developmental levels of different ages of children.

Designed for young children and their caregivers, Library storytimes engage participants with fun, dynamic early learning activities.

During a 45 to 60 minute storytime with a Children’s Staff member, children and their caregivers share books, songs and action rhymes which support healthy, whole-child development and social-emotional skills.

All storytimes feature an assortment of age-appropriate stories, rhymes and more to help your child develop language and early literacy skills and promote a love of reading.
